Name and Location
A’Chruach wind farm, Scotland.

Client
Infinis Energy.

Project Description
The project involves the construction and operation of the A’Chruach wind farm, located in Argyle and Bute.

The wind farm will have a capacity of 43 MW. The wind farm will consist of 21 turbines.

Value
In November, Infinis signed a six-year £52-million project financing facility to fund the construction and operation of the wind farm.

Duration
The wind farm is expected to be operational by March 16.

Latest Developments
A possible second phase of the project is being considered, which will consist of the addition of three turbines, located on moorland to the east of the main wind farm.

Key Contracts and Suppliers
Senivon (turbines and full maintenance of the plant for five years).

On Budget and on Time?
Not stated.
